Rutgers football’s bowl hopes take major hit with loss to Illinois
CHAMPAIGN, Ill. — Luke Altmyer threw for 235 yards and four touchdowns and ran for 88 yards and a TD to lead Illinois to a 35-13 victory Saturday over Rutgers. Altmyer completed 19 of 31 passes as the Illini (6-3, 3-3 Big Ten) ended a two-game losing streak and became bowl-eligible in back-to-back seasons for the first time since 2010-11. “I put us as good as any 6-3 team out there.
